RATE OF PLAY
Each player receives 90 minutes plus 30-second increment per move from move one.
Digital clocks will be used. Default time 30 minutes after scheduled start time.
90 minutes plus 30 seconds per move from start of game (all sections).
CONDITIONS OF ENTRY
Participation in this Congress implies acceptance of the Congress
Players must abide by the FIDE Laws of Chess and any decisions made by the controllers in interpretation of the Laws are final.
The March 2026 ECF OTB Rating List will be used to determine section allocation, Ungraded players must provide evidence of their playing strength, including recent results, previous grades, prizes won and a reasonable estimate of grading. Prizes for ungraded players will be at the discretion of the congress committee.
The congress committee reserves the right to refuse entry and to transfer competitors to other sections and to cancel or split any section at their discretion. If a player has not arrived for their game within 30 minutes of the start time, the player will be defaulted, and the controllers may re-pair games.
